12.4.1
Initialisation Of The Power/Control Module After Installation –
Non-Ice & Water Models
The power/control module needs to know whether it is fitted into a "B" or "T" model upon installation because
it needs to turn on the interior light, and to identify the PC and FC compartments for the selected
temperature settings.
To initialise, the serviceperson must have the FC door closed, the PC door open and then press any of the
buttons on the user interface in the PC. This will initialise the module for the cabinet it is fitted into. Until
then, the interior light may not turn on, indicating that the power/control module has not been initialised.
If the power/control module is moved from one cabinet to another and the model option is wrong, the PC
light will turn on only when the FC door is opened. Initialise the power/control module as described in the
previous paragraph.
If the power/control module is not initialised, as may be the situation for a new service module, the lights will
not turn on. If the operator presses a button with both doors opened, the illegal raspberry audible feedback
will sound, indicating that the module is unable to be initialised. The service installation document, which is
included with the new service module, will give instructions on the initialisation of the module.
12.5
Freezer Bin, Runner and Air Deflector Removal - E402B
and E372B Models
1.
Disconnect the refrigerator from the power supply.
2.
Remove the top shelf by lifting the rear of the shelf to release it from its locked position and slide the
shelf forward.
3.
Remove the limit stops from the top rear edge of the plastic bins and slide the bins out of the runners.
4.
The runners must be in the fully retracted position. Twist and rotate the inner runner upwards to release
it from the outer runner.
5.
Pull the inner runner forward, sliding out of the outer runner to remove.
6.
To remove the outer runner, gently lever out the small lock clip with a small screwdriver.
7.
Carefully slide the runner out of the FC liner.
8.
Remove the air deflector by pushing in towards the centre to bow the deflector slightly. This will cause
the clip legs to disengage from the front cover and allow the deflector to be removed.
9.
Refit in reverse order.
12.6

FC Bin Removal - 900 Models

1.
Open the FC drawer and remove all ice and storage bins.
2.
Remove the safety clip from the tray. (Refer photo 12.6)
3.
Remove the tray.
4.
To remove the bin, pull it back towards the freezer.
5.
